Shortly after the departure of Ilkay Gündogan to Barcelona, Manchester City already found a replacement for him with the signing of Mateo Kovacic. The Citizens paid Chelsea close to 29 million euros and Kovacic signed a four-year contract, as reported in the official statement of the sky-blue club.

This Tuesday he experienced his first meeting with the press as a Manchester City player, and he did not want to miss the opportunity to give his new coach his ears. "I've learned a lot from all my coaches. Especially from Tuchel at Chelsea. But now it's time to learn from the best (for Pep)," Kovacic said.

After having won the Champions League, Josep Guardiola is reinforced with a signing that knows how to win this competition very well. The former Real Madrid had the opportunity to conquer it four times, three with the White House and one with the Blues. Now, he will seek to replace the void that Gundogan leaves in his squad.

The correct age according to Mateo Kovacic

The Croatian midfielder thinks that it is the special moment to put himself under the orders of Pep Guardiola. "I come at the right age. I'm 29 years old, a family. It's the perfect time for such a big club and with such an incredible coach," said the now ex-Chelsea, who will have another great coach in his history after having Zidane and Tuchel.
